Sources say Doherty accepts reins at SMU Incentive-laden deal could pay ex-UNC coach $600,000LINK

11:19 AM CDT on [highlight]Monday, April 24, 2006[/highlight]

By CALVIN WATKINS / The Dallas Morning News

UNIVERSITY PARK – After several days of negotiating and trying to decide, Matt Doherty is leaving Florida Atlantic for SMU.

On Sunday, Doherty accepted an offer to coach the men's basketball team at SMU, according to university sources.

SMU president Gerald Turner met with Doherty on Sunday afternoon and finalized the deal.

Doherty will meet with the 18-person search committee today and, if approved, probably will be introduced no later than Tuesday, sources said.

Doherty was unavailable for comment.

Doherty will replace Jimmy Tubbs, who was fired this month.

The hire ends days of talks that started last Monday when Doherty officially interviewed with incoming athletic director Steve Orsini.

When Doherty was offered the job at midweek, he told SMU officials he needed to think about it.

Orsini didn't return a phone call seeking comment.

SMU made the job difficult to turn down.

Doherty was offered a yearly [highlight]salary of $600,000 if incentives are met. [/highlight]

Doherty earned a base salary of $171,000 at Florida Atlantic. Tubbs was to earn $325,000 in the third year of his contract and $400,000 in the fourth year. When SMU fired Tubbs, it reached a deal that paid him in excess of $600,000.

Doherty asked for an increase in the basketball budget and $300,000 in salaries for assistant coaches. He also demanded a commitment to a basketball practice facility and upgrades to Moody Coliseum, sources said.

Doherty leaves Florida Atlantic after one season where he went 15-13 and lost in the quarterfinals of the Atlantic Sun conference tournament.

"I think he did a super job," FAU athletic director Craig Angelos told the South Florida Sun-Sentinel. "He left the program in much better shape than when he took over."

Doherty has a $200,000 buyout in his Florida Atlantic contract.

Doherty made a splash at Florida Atlantic after [highlight]he spent two seasons away from the game working for ESPN and CSTV. [/highlight]

But Doherty made his name at [highlight]North Carolina, where he once played. He coached three seasons at North Carolina, going 26-7 in his first campaign. He was named Associated Press National Coach of the Year after that year. [/highlight]

But after two difficult seasons, he was forced to resign with a 53-43 mark.

"Matt was a little overwhelmed with that job at first," said the Mavericks' Jerry Stackhouse, a UNC alum. "He's a great recruiter, and he has a chance to end up as a great coach somewhere. It's a good move for him. Texas is Texas, and it's a state with great players."

[highlight]Before UNC, Doherty spent one season at Notre Dame, where he went 22-15. [/highlight]

Now, he's coming to the Hilltop with a chance to rebuild a struggling program that hasn't been to the NCAA Tournament since 1993 and last had a winning season in 2002-03.

E-mail cwatkins@dallasnews.com

MATT DOHERTY

Age: 44

Career record: 90-71

Notable: Graduated from North Carolina in 1984 with a degree in business administration and dean's list honors. ... Was a teammate of Michael Jordan at UNC. ... Worked in New York City for three years as a bond salesman for Kidder Peabody & Co. Inc. before getting into coaching. ... Served as an assistant coach at Davidson and Kansas before his first head coaching job. ... Considered a strong recruiter.

DOHERTY YEAR-BY-YEAR  

Season  School  Record  

1999-2000  Notre Dame  22-15  

2000-01  North Carolina  26-7  

2001-02  North Carolina  8-20  

2002-03  North Carolina  19-16  

2005-06  Florida Atlantic  15-13
